1 Peter 4:8

Above all, maintain an intense love for each other, since love covers a multitude of sins.

Proverbs 10:12

Hatred stirs up conflicts,
but love covers all offenses.

James 5:20

let him know that whoever turns a sinner from the error of his way will save his life from death and cover a multitude of sins.

1 Peter 1:22

By obedience to the truth, having purified yourselves for sincere love of the brothers, love one another earnestly from a pure heart,

Proverbs 17:9

Whoever conceals an offense promotes love,
but whoever gossips about it separates friends.

Colossians 3:14

Above all, put on love—the perfect bond of unity.
